Barium Chloride Anhydrous
Anhydrous barium chloride (BaCl2) is a hygroscopic white powder employed in pyrotechnics, pigment production, and metal refining. Classified under HTS 2827.39.45.00 as 'other chlorides of barium,' it represents pure, chemically defined forms beyond commercial grades.

Import Tips & Compliance
• Label packages with GHS corrosive pictograms and ensure DOT-compliant shipping for hazardous solids
• Provide supplier specs confirming anhydrous state to distinguish from dihydrate forms
• Check for barium content restrictions under TSCA for US chemical import registration

Barium Chloride Dihydrate
Barium chloride dihydrate (BaCl2·2H2O) is a white crystalline inorganic compound used in chemical synthesis, water treatment, and as a heat-treating salt. It falls under HTS 2827.39.45.00 as a chemically defined chloride of barium, specifically classified among other barium chlorides excluding certain commercial forms.
High-Purity Barium Chloride
High-purity barium chloride (99.99% BaCl2) is utilized in optical glass manufacturing and as a precursor for barium titanate ceramics. It qualifies for HTS 2827.39.45.00 due to its status as a chemically defined barium chloride, meeting Chapter 28 Note 1 purity criteria.
Barium Chloride Laboratory Reagent
ACS-grade barium chloride reagent is supplied in small bottles for analytical chemistry and precipitation tests. Under HTS 2827.39.45.00, it is classified as other barium chlorides when not qualifying as a retail preparation.
Technical Grade Barium Chloride
Technical grade barium chloride crystals serve in industrial water softening and as a mordant in textile dyeing. HTS 2827.39.45.00 covers this as a chemically defined barium chloride of other types.
